APOEL players Stafylidis and Laifis target return from injury

APOEL players Kostas Stafylidis and Konstantinos Laifis are nearing their return to action following respective injury setbacks. Stafylidis, a key left-back for coach Pablo Garcia, is expected to be fit for the upcoming playoff match against Aris on April 5, 2026, at GSP Stadium. Defender Konstantinos Laifis, who sustained a facial injury against Anorthosis on March 8, 2026, has begun strength training and is being fitted for a protective mask. While his availability for the Aris match remains uncertain, club officials are optimistic that he will be ready for the following match against Apollon on April 14, 2026. Stafylidis has recorded seven assists in 19 league appearances this season, making his return vital for the team's offensive strategy. Other players, including Diamantakos, Kattirtzis, and Meurer, are also expected to return for the final stretch of the domestic season. The team continues to compete in both the league and the cup under Garcia's tactical planning.
